    ICE arrests Palestinian activist who helped lead Columbia University protests : NPR

    NEW YORK — Federal immigration authorities arrested a Palestinian activist Saturday who performed a outstanding position in Columbia College’s protests in opposition to Israel, a major escalation within the Trump administration’s pledge to detain and deport pupil activists.

    Mahmoud Khalil, a graduate pupil at Columbia till this previous December, was inside his university-owned condominium Saturday night time when a number of Immigration and Customs Enforcement brokers entered and took him into custody, his legal professional, Amy Greer, advised The Related Press.

    Greer mentioned she spoke by telephone with one of many ICE brokers through the arrest, who mentioned they had been performing on State Division orders to revoke Khalil’s pupil visa. Knowledgeable by the legal professional that Khalil was in the US as a everlasting resident with a inexperienced card, the agent mentioned they had been revoking that as a substitute, in keeping with the lawyer.

    A spokesperson for the Division of Homeland Safety, Tricia McLaughlin, confirmed Khalil’s arrest in an announcement Sunday, describing it as being “in help of President Trump’s govt orders prohibiting anti-Semitism.”

    Khalil’s arrest is the primary publicly recognized deportation effort underneath Trump’s promised crackdown on college students who joined protests in opposition to the battle in Gaza that swept school campuses final spring. The administration has claimed contributors forfeited their rights to stay within the nation by supporting Hamas.

    McLaughlin signaled the arrest was straight related to Khalil’s position within the protests, alleging he “led actions aligned to Hamas, a chosen terrorist group.”

    As ICE brokers arrived at Khalil’s Manhattan residence Saturday night time, additionally they threatened to arrest Khalil’s spouse, an American citizen who’s eight months pregnant, Greer mentioned.

    Khalil’s legal professional mentioned they had been initially knowledgeable that he was being held at an immigration detention facility in Elizabeth, New Jersey. However when his spouse tried to go to Sunday, she discovered he was not there. Greer mentioned she nonetheless didn’t know Khalil’s whereabouts as of Sunday night time.

    “We now have not been in a position to get any extra particulars about why he’s being detained,” Greer advised the AP. “This can be a clear escalation. The administration is following via on its threats.”

    A Columbia College spokesperson mentioned regulation enforcement brokers should produce a warrant earlier than coming into college property, however declined to say if the college had obtained one forward of Khalil’s arrest. The spokesperson declined to touch upon Khalil’s detention.

    In a message shared on X Sunday night, Secretary of State Marco Rubio mentioned the administration “can be revoking the visas and/or inexperienced playing cards of Hamas supporters in America to allow them to be deported.”

    The Division of Homeland Safety can provoke deportation proceedings in opposition to inexperienced card holders for a broad vary of alleged legal exercise, together with supporting a terror group. However the detention of a authorized everlasting resident who has not been charged with against the law marked a rare transfer with an unsure authorized basis, in keeping with immigration specialists.

    “This has the looks of a retaliatory motion in opposition to somebody who expressed an opinion the Trump administration did not like,” mentioned Camille Mackler, founding father of Immigrant ARC, a coalition of authorized service suppliers in New York.

    Khalil, who obtained his grasp’s diploma from Columbia’s faculty of worldwide affairs final semester, served as a negotiator for college kids as they bargained with college officers over an finish to the tent encampment erected on campus final spring.

    The position made him probably the most seen activists in help of the motion, prompting calls from pro-Israel activists in current weeks for the Trump administration to start deportation proceedings in opposition to him.

    Khalil was additionally amongst these underneath investigation by a brand new Columbia College workplace that has introduced disciplinary fees in opposition to dozens of scholars for his or her pro-Palestinian activism, in keeping with information shared with the AP.

    The investigations come because the Trump administration has adopted via on its menace to chop tons of of hundreds of thousands of {dollars} in funding to Columbia due to what the federal government describes because the Ivy League faculty’s failure to squelch antisemitism on campus.

    The college’s allegations in opposition to Khalil targeted on his involvement within the Columbia College Apartheid Divest group. He confronted sanctions for doubtlessly serving to to prepare an “unauthorized marching occasion” wherein contributors glorified Hamas’ Oct. 7, 2023, assault and taking part in a “substantial position” within the circulation of social media posts criticizing Zionism, amongst different acts of alleged discrimination.

    “I’ve round 13 allegations in opposition to me, most of them are social media posts that I had nothing to do with,” Khalil advised the AP final week.

    “They only need to present Congress and right-wing politicians that they are doing one thing, whatever the stakes for college kids,” he added. “It is primarily an workplace to sit back pro-Palestine speech.”
